Allen Sweeps Neosho

The Allen Men's Basketball team completed the season sweep of rival Neosho CC by the score of 90-76. The Red Devils struggled early in the game to cut into Neosho's zone defense, but as the game went on Allen was able to get going from the 3 point line to help earn the victory. Allen connected on 12 three pointers on the night to Neosho's 3 made three point attempts. In the early going both teams traded the lead, as there were 15 lead changes, with all of the lead changes occurring in the first half. Allen was able to grab a 2 point half time lead, 43-41, in large part to Quentin Blaue knocking down back to back 3's in the last minute of the first half.

 

In the second half Allen was able to separate in the early going, and pushed the lead to 19 points with 14 minutes left to play in the game. Once again, Quentin Blaue got going from the 3 point line early in the second half to help spark the big run for the Red Devils. Blaue finished the game 6/12 from the 3 point line, scoring 20 points. DaRon Mims had a huge night for Allen, scoring 32 points and grabbing 5 rebounds, and 3 steals. Mims was able to score in transition throughout the game, and also did a good job from the free-throw line, connecting on 13 of his 14 attempts.

 

Jah-Kobe Womack played big for the Red Devils, as he scored 16 points and grabbed 4 rebounds. Womack provided an early spark scoring in the first half and made some big baskets late in the game as well. EJ Garnes continued his solid play, scoring 15 points and dishing out 8 assists on the night. Garnes had success driving and kicking against Neosho's zone defense.

 

With the win, Allen improves to 7-8 in Jayhawk Conference play, and also jumps back above .500 on the season with an overall record of 10-9. Allen will return home for rematch with Colby CC on Wednesday night at 8:00 PM. Allen won their last matchup with Colby on a last second buzzer beater by DaRon Mims.
